Mita Nangia Goswami - Community Outreach Leader

Mita Nangia Goswami, Community Outreach Leader.

I raise people’s awareness and help them become part of the conservation process.
What do you like?
I love the bond with communities and sharing a view that they may not have had before to make their lives better.
What do you dislike?
The terrible roads we travel on.
How did you get involved in conservation?
I’ve been working with communities since 1995. When I heard there was work looking at communities and elephant conservation, I jumped at it. Communities and conservation are two sides of the same coin and I wanted to see how I could use my experience.
What are your hopes for the future?
I am very optimistic. There is a long way to go but we will be able to bring about change, reclaim the forest and do enough to make things better.
